What's the stability & growth outlook for Finn Partners?
Strengths in market position, global expansion, and innovation are tempered by slower recent revenue momentum and uneven staffing dynamics in select practices. Together, these dynamics suggest a resilient, well-positioned firm whose near-term trajectory is steady rather than hypergrowth while it integrates acquisitions and scales new offerings.
Key Insight for Candidates
Defining tradeoff: acquisition‑driven global expansion (notably Europe and Southeast Asia) alongside modest organic growth and leaner staffing. Expect cross‑border opportunities and new capabilities, but frequent integration cycles and heightened productivity expectations can raise workload and change velocity.Evidence in Action
- Acquisition-Led Global Expansion — Claudine Colin Communication (July 2024) and RICE Communications (March 2025) acquisitions expanded EMEA/APAC, adding Thailand and Myanmar offices and reestablishing the Philippines, lifting APAC headcount to ~250. Teams gain regional coverage, cross-border client flow, and more internal mobility during market shocks.
- Specialty Launches for Resilience — Media forensics/risk intelligence and FINN Luxe launches accompanied a 2% 2024 fee rise to ~$199.8M and 200+ new clients. Employees see steadier pipelines and higher-value briefs in misinformation defense and luxury, buffering volatility.
Positive Themes About Finn Partners
-
Strong Market Position & Advantage: Recognition as a top agency (e.g., #5 in O’Dwyer’s 2025) and leadership in Education, Travel, and Purpose/CSR indicate durable competitive standing across regions and verticals. Feedback suggests consistent awards and top-tier placements by major industry publications reinforce this market advantage.
-
Market Expansion: Ongoing acquisitions in Europe and Asia and a footprint of 35 offices across three continents show broadening geographic reach. Feedback suggests hundreds of new clients added and strengthened practices across sectors are extending the firm’s presence.
-
Innovation-Driven Growth: Launches of AI-powered tools (AIristotle, Media Forensics, Canary for Crisis) and initiatives like Opportunity 250 illustrate active investment in new capabilities. Feedback suggests these offerings enhance competitive positioning and open additional growth avenues.
Considerations About Finn Partners
-
Stagnant Revenue: Recent results included a slight dip in fee income in 2023 and only modest growth in 2024, indicating slower topline momentum. Feedback suggests growth has normalized from earlier rapid expansion amid a challenging market.
-
Workforce Instability: Some practices showed revenue growth alongside decreased full-time headcount, pointing to uneven staffing trends and potential resourcing imbalances. Feedback suggests headcount gains have not been uniform across the organization.
